We are looking for an early years educator to prepare small children for kindergarten by easing them into organized education. You will teach them important elements that they will encounter soon after they enter school life. A preschool teacher is responsible for ensuring that children are taught in a fun and educational way that appeals to all children. An excellent early years teacher must be able to lead them in activities that they find difficult or boring, while also making them feel safe and secure in their learning. **Responsibilities**:

- Develop a careful and creative program suitable for preschool children
- Employ a variety of educational techniques (storytelling, educational play, media etc.)to teach children
- Observe each child to help them improve their social competencies and build self-esteem
- Encourage children to interact with each other and resolve occasional arguments
- Guide children to develop their artistic and practical capabilities through a carefully constructed curriculum (identify shapes, numbers or colors, do crafts etc.)
- Organize nap and snack hours and supervise children to ensure they are safe at all times
- Track children’s progress and report to parents
- Communicate with parents regularly to understand the children’s background and psyche
